    Abstract: A solar cell array (30), a solar cell module (100) and a manufacturing method thereof are disclosed. The solar cell array (30) includes a plurality of cells (31) and a plurality of conductive wires (32). Adjacent cells (31) are connected by the plurality of conductive wires (32). Each cell (31) has a front surface on which light is incident when the cell (31) is in operation and a back surface opposite to the front surface. The solar cell array (30) further comprises secondary grid lines (312) disposed on the front surface of the respective cell (31). The secondary grid lines (312) comprise middle secondary grid lines (3122) disposed in the middle of the respective cell (31) and intersected with the conductive wires (32). The secondary grid lines (312) also comprise edge secondary grid lines (3121) disposed on the edges of the respective cell (31) and non-intersected with the conductive wires (32). The solar cell array (30) also comprises short grid lines (33) disposed on a front surface of the cell (31). The short grid lines (33) connect the edge secondary grid lines (3121) with the conductive wires (32) or with at least one middle secondary grid line (3122).

    Abstract: The disclosure discloses a photovoltaic cell, a photovoltaic cell array, a solar cell, and a method for preparing a photovoltaic cell. The photovoltaic cell includes: a silicon wafer, a gate line layer, a side electrode, a first electrode, a back electrical layer, and a second electrode. The silicon wafer includes a silicon substrate, a front diffusion layer, a side division layer, and a back division layer. At least a part of at least one of the side division layer and the back division layer is a diffusion layer whose type is the same as that of the front diffusion layer. The gate line layer is disposed on the front diffusion layer. The side electrode is disposed on the side division layer and is electrically connected to the gate line layer. The first electrode is disposed on the back division layer and is electrically connected to the side electrode. The back electrical layer and the second electrode are both disposed on a back surface of the silicon wafer. The back electrical layer is electrically connected to the second electrode and is not in contact with the first electrode.
